Mahoosuc Community Band to play September concert
Mahoosuc Community Band will play a concert at 6:30 p.m. on Monday, Sept. 13, at the Bethel Common gazebo. After over a year of not playing music together, members of the Mahoosuc Community Band started rehearsing in June. Rusty at first, the band has worked hard to make music together again. Dance block party to be held in Norway
DJ Thunder will provide the tunes from 2-5 p.m. on Sunday, Sept. 12, at Temple Street Dance Park in Norway. The event is presented by Cottage Street Creative Exchange.
